Fourth Industrial Revolution for Development: The Relevance of Cloud Federation in Healthcare Support
Olasupo O. Ajayi, Antoine B. Bagula, Kun Ma

TL;DR
This paper explores how federated cloud computing can improve healthcare infrastructure in Africa by enabling resource sharing among medical facilities, using simulations to evaluate different collaboration models and workload schemes.
Contribution
It proposes a federated cloud model for African healthcare, analyzing cooperative and competitive collaboration strategies through simulation to optimize resource utilization and service quality.
Findings
Cooperative model reduces delays but increases resource utilization.
Competitive model offers faster service and better quality.
BFD and BSBF schemes optimize resource use and energy conservation.
Abstract
Inefficient healthcare is a major concern among many African nations and can be mitigated by building world-class infrastructure connecting different medical facilities for collaboration and resource sharing. Such infrastructure should support collection and exchange of medical data for the purpose of accessing expertise not available locally. It should be equipped with modern technologies of the fourth industrial revolution, providing decision support to doctors thereby enabling African nations leapfrog from poorly equipped to medically prepared. Sadly, world-class healthcare infrastructure are a missing piece in the African public health ecosystem. Medical facilities are either non-existent or prohibitively expensive when they exist.
